Transaction 36cbef890176b97dcde9fed9a6423a7524ccca83901fc18aa857966ef282fbfa

1 Input
2 Outputs
  • 36cbef890176b97dcde9fed9a6423a7524ccca83901fc18aa857966ef282fbfa:0
  • value  134051
    address  1KYcRXg7QVEbYytyZ1XiwVcpxCmHaAmfPP
  • 36cbef890176b97dcde9fed9a6423a7524ccca83901fc18aa857966ef282fbfa:1
  • value  4123366
    address  159G6tRyr23d2CzXH4mPhJAc9iQz258hBi